Understanding Digital Payment Systems

Digital payment systems refer to electronic methods of processing financial transactions. These systems enable users to make payments for goods and services through digital means rather than traditional cash or checks. Digital payments can be initiated using various devices, including smartphones, computers, and point-of-sale terminals. The adoption of digital payment systems has been facilitated by advancements in technology, increasing consumer demand for convenience, and the proliferation of e-commerce.

Types of Digital Payment Systems

Digital payment systems can be categorized into several types, each serving different purposes and functionalities:

  • Credit and Debit Cards: Traditional payment cards that allow consumers to make purchases using borrowed or deposited funds.
  • Mobile Wallets: Applications that enable users to store payment information and make transactions using their smartphones. Examples include Apple Pay, Google Pay, and Samsung Pay.
  • Online Payment Gateways: Platforms that facilitate online transactions by securely processing payment information. PayPal, Stripe, and Square are notable examples.
  • Cryptocurrency: Digital currencies that utilize blockchain technology for secure and decentralized transactions. Bitcoin and Ethereum are prominent cryptocurrencies.
  • Bank Transfers: Electronic transfers of funds between bank accounts, often facilitated through services like ACH (Automated Clearing House) or wire transfers.

Technological Innovations in Digital Payment Systems

The evolution of digital payment systems is closely tied to technological advancements. Key technologies shaping the landscape of digital payments include:

1. Mobile Technology

The widespread adoption of smartphones has revolutionized digital payments. Mobile payment solutions allow users to make transactions on-the-go, enhancing convenience and accessibility. Near Field Communication (NFC) technology enables contactless payments, where consumers can simply tap their devices to complete transactions.

2. Blockchain Technology

Blockchain technology underpins many cryptocurrencies and offers a decentralized and secure method of recording transactions. This technology enhances transparency and reduces the risk of fraud in digital payment systems. Blockchain’s immutable ledger makes it an attractive option for cross-border transactions, providing faster and cheaper alternatives to traditional banking systems.

3. Artificial Intelligence (AI)

AI is increasingly used in digital payment systems to enhance security and improve user experience. Machine learning algorithms analyze transaction data to detect fraudulent activities, flagging suspicious transactions in real-time. Additionally, AI-powered chatbots provide customer support, assisting users with payment-related inquiries.

4. Biometric Authentication

Biometric authentication methods, such as fingerprint scanning and facial recognition, add an extra layer of security to digital payment systems. By using unique biological traits, these methods help prevent unauthorized access to payment information. Biometric authentication is particularly prevalent in mobile payment applications, where convenience and security are paramount.

5. Cloud Computing

Cloud computing facilitates the storage and processing of payment data in a secure and scalable manner. Payment processors can leverage cloud technology to handle high transaction volumes, ensuring reliability and efficiency. Additionally, cloud-based solutions enable businesses to access payment systems from anywhere, enhancing operational flexibility.

Advantages of Digital Payment Systems

The shift towards digital payment systems offers numerous advantages for consumers, businesses, and the economy as a whole:

1. Convenience and Speed

Digital payment systems streamline the payment process, allowing users to complete transactions quickly and conveniently. Consumers can shop online or in-store without the need for cash or checks, reducing transaction times and enhancing the overall shopping experience.

2. Enhanced Security

Digital payment systems often employ advanced security measures, such as encryption and tokenization, to protect sensitive financial information. These technologies mitigate the risk of fraud and unauthorized access, providing consumers with greater peace of mind when making transactions.

3. Increased Accessibility

Digital payment systems enable individuals without access to traditional banking services to participate in the economy. Mobile payment solutions can reach underserved populations, providing them with the means to make purchases and engage in financial activities.

4. Cost-Effectiveness for Businesses

For businesses, digital payment systems can reduce operational costs associated with handling cash and processing checks. Additionally, lower transaction fees for digital payments compared to traditional payment methods can enhance profitability.

5. Improved Record-Keeping

Digital payment systems automatically generate transaction records, facilitating easier bookkeeping and accounting for businesses. This feature streamlines financial management and provides valuable insights into consumer behavior and spending patterns.

Challenges Facing Digital Payment Systems

Despite their advantages, digital payment systems face several challenges that must be addressed to ensure widespread adoption and effectiveness:

1. Cybersecurity Threats

As digital payment systems become more prevalent, they also attract cybercriminals seeking to exploit vulnerabilities. Businesses and consumers must remain vigilant against potential threats, implementing robust cybersecurity measures to safeguard payment information.

2. Regulatory Compliance

Digital payment systems must comply with various regulations governing financial transactions, including anti-money laundering (AML) and know your customer (KYC) requirements. Navigating the complex regulatory landscape can pose challenges for businesses operating in multiple jurisdictions.

3. Digital Divide

The digital divide—disparities in access to technology—can hinder the adoption of digital payment systems. Populations lacking access to smartphones or reliable internet connections may be excluded from the benefits of digital payments, perpetuating economic inequalities.

4. Consumer Trust

Building consumer trust in digital payment systems is crucial for their success. Concerns about data privacy, security, and the reliability of payment processors can deter individuals from using digital payment methods. Educating consumers about the safety and benefits of digital payments is essential in fostering trust.
